Re: injector pump problems DB 880

like NHBoyd suggested, check for flow into the lowpressure pump (like an old automotive fuel pump) i think most of the david b's have a suction fuel line that goes up and enters the fuel tank from the top. so you need a good clean line into the low pump. mine has dual filters, if you have not changed them, it may be time. then bleed all air out of the lines. the cav injectors seem harder to purge air than other types i've fooled with. the run and stop symptom is indicative a fuel supply problem, not an injector pump problem.
